Bulk Anti-Human CD68 (KP1) Antibody

Product Specifications

Background

KP1 was originally used as a pan-monocytic/macrophage marker against CD68; however, CD68 is not a macrophage specific antigen and KP1 is known to stain neutrophils and other non-macrophage-like cells. KP1 reacts against CD68 in a wide range of healthy and disease-associated (rheumatoid arthritis and osteoarthritis) 5 tissues as well as a variety of neoplasms, tumor cell lines, and tumor-associated macrophages. KP1 detects a fixation-resistant epitope that is likely glycan-based which is shared by many cell types. KP1 was developed by immunizing Balb/c mice against a lysosomal fraction of human lung . Hybridoma supernatants derived from spleen cells were screened on cryostat human lung and tonsil sections as well as paraffin wax sections of lung tissue fixed in formol saline.

Antigen Distribution

CD68 is found in the cytoplasm of monocytes/macrophages, fibroblasts, human peripheral blood lymphocytes, neutrophil primary and mast cell granules, large granular lymphocytes, basophils, basal epithelial cell layers, renal glomeruli, myeloid cells, endothelial cells, retinal epithelial cells, osteoblasts, fibroblast-like cells from bone marrow, and a wide-range of lymphoid neoplasms. CD68 is predominantly located in lysosomal membranes, with a small amount on the cell surface. Additionally, CD68 can be expressed in most hematopoietic cell lines by phorbol-induced differentiation; soluble CD68 can also be found in serum and urine.
